## Further Reading

So, the string-extraction script (`polyglot-pull`) walks the Fernwheel codebase and scrapes every translatable string into the catalog. If support sees an untranslated phrase in the app, odds are the string was added without the marker the script looks for. You don't need to run it yourselves — just file it. What counts as extractable, and common gotchas, are explained on the page below.

operations page: https://jenkins.zemvarcloud.local/job/merge_requests/repo/build/73930b4b30f0a8ed

Leadership Review Briefing — Loyalty Overhaul

Quick heads-up for sales leads: the Meridell Rewards revamp lands next quarter. Points will roll over, tiers drop from five to three, and redemption goes instant. Early pilots in the Carwyn region showed a 12% bump in repeat orders. Before you brief your teams, read the confidential note below.

confidential, hahap-taweg: Headcount on the Zorath team goes from 7 to 140 by the end of January. Gross margin on Zorath came in at 15 percent against a plan of 20 percent.

Nice work on the formatter, but please don't hardcode the `DD/MM/YYYY` pattern here — the Lumenside app ships in eleven locales, and the Quarrow rendering layer expects pattern keys, not literals. Future maintainers will need to adjust fallbacks per region, so route everything through the locale table. The relevant tuning constants are as follows.

tuning constants:
RATE_LIMITS = {
    "wenwyn": 1,
    "zorix": 10,
    "oliix": 2,
    "holael": 10,
}

## Digest Scheduling

The Pennywhistle digest batcher groups pending notifications per recipient and flushes on a fixed cadence, with jitter added to avoid synchronized load on the send pool. If a flush window is missed, items roll into the next window rather than sending immediately; this is intentional and prevents burst sends after outages. Do not shorten the cadence without also raising the send-pool concurrency, or the queue will back up silently. The scheduler reads its settings at boot only, and the current values appear below.

settings of tagef-bawif:
DRUIX_HOST=druix.zemvarlabs.internal
DRUIX_PORT=8000